Freshly shorn - getting a haircut or shave gives a Charisma bonus. There are charisma bonuses regarding bath wenches or from being in a relationship (won’t put out any spoilers). A lot of the other buffs rely on drinking potions that last a limited amount of time. You can easily search KCD buffs for a list of the others.

Seek! is a Houndmaster perk in Kingdom Come: Deliverance. Your dog is able to sniff out interesting places. With your best friend's help, nothing will escape you. This is one of the best Houndmaster perks, if not the best, because it allows players to find otherwise hidden spots throughout the game. Marathoner perk is the worst perk. When you choose between Marathoner and Sprinter, you are basically going “do you wanna go faster or slower”. It just makes Sprinter all the better though because all that speed that Sprinter gives you is really good for combat. Also, both sprinter and Marathoner run the same distance.
